Construction Materials for Civil Engineering Course
This course equips civil engineers with expertise in choosing construction materials like concrete and steel for structural elements. Using ASCE 7, ACI, and AISC standards, you'll evaluate loads, select systems for floors, roofs, and lateral stability, and balance cost, durability, fire safety, and buildability for optimal, safe designs.
